CVE-2012-5054

Impact:
Critical
Public Date:
2012-09-11
CWE:
CWE-190
Bugzilla:
860060: CVE-2012-5054 flash-plugin: arbitrary code exec via integer overflow in copyRawDataTo method in Matrix3D class

The MITRE CVE dictionary describes this issue as:

Integer overflow in the copyRawDataTo method in the Matrix3D class in Adobe Flash Player before 11.4.402.265 all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via malformed arguments.

CVSS v2 metrics

Base Score 6.8
Base Metrics AV:N/AC:M/Au:N/C:P/I:P/A:P
Access Vector Network
Access Complexity Medium
Authentication None
Confidentiality Impact Partial
Integrity Impact Partial
Availability Impact Partial
